I like to give mine some variety. So far they'll eat mysis, frozen Formula II, squid (small pieces), flake (several different varieties), Brine Shrimp Plus, spirulina (sp?), and even cyclopeeze (frozen). Actually, I'd say they'll eat darn near anything except the nori I stick in the tank for the tangs. ;)

The more of a variety you give them, the healthier they will be.
